I had a couple hours the other day and decided to go hunt for a 1700s fort site. I walked up to the top of a steep hill with a nice flat spot on top. Got some iron signals up there but nothing significant. Then I hit a weird little signal and dug this very deep copper disc. Worst I've ever seen

Soooooooo I was left thinking that this wasn't the spot. Just not enough there. I started detecting down the hillside and got a couple of solid signals right next to eachother. Dug down and found a round ball. Stuck my propointer in and found another. Kept on checking and out they came. 39 of them in all. Not all the same size which I thought was a bit odd. I was also surprised that they weren't spread around more. They were in a fairly small area. So now I'm just not sure if I'm in the right spot or not :tongue3:

I hope this isn't a big joke where I happen to be the only sucker taking the bait (no pun intended) but the balls with the splits are called split shot, and are used as fishing line weights. Still at all bait and tackle stores, at least down South. The other finds are cool though, Abe.

Okay, bracing for the laughter...

No these are actually round balls. They're much bigger than split shot. The seam is a mold seam and you can also see where they cut the sprue off. I will post a close up pic tonight. They're much much bigger than they appear in the pics. Scouts honor
